With astroturfing being a theme among food bloggers over the past week or so, it’s time I took you to a brothel. Sorry, not brothel but Madame Brussels, a bar named after a famous brothel that operated in Melbourne in the late 1900s.
With its astroturfed, kitsch garden theme Madame Brussels (Level 3, 59-63 Bourke St, Melbourne +61 3 9662 2775) sits three floors up in a fairly dreadful office building with an entrance garnished with worn fawn carpet (and above a Japanese club that I am curious about).
Inside this oasis, I escape to what must be Melbourne’s best roof terrace for a crafty fag. Back inside, the Madame has an excellent selection of spirits. I taste three interesting pastis, although will their own subtle flavours.
Nothing fake here. Apart from the grass, of course.
